About Sourangsu Sarkar

Sourangsu Sarkar is a scholar working on Biomaterials, Ceramics and Composites and Polymers and Plastics, having authored 13 papers that have together received 559 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Carbon Nanotubes in Composites (5 papers), Electrospun Nanofibers in Biomedical Applications (3 papers) and Silk-based biomaterials and applications (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Ceramics and Composites (102 citations), Biomaterials (147 citations) and Polymers and Plastics (151 citations). Sourangsu Sarkar has collaborated with scholars based in United States and Canada. Frequent co-authors include Lei Zhai, Linan An, Anindarupa Chunder, Zhehong Gan, Allison M. Beese, SonBinh T. Nguyen, Horacio D. Espinosa, Satish Kumar, Nikhil Verghese and Po‐Hsiang Wang. Their work appears in journals such as ACS Nano, Advanced Functional Materials and ACS Applied Materials & Interfaces.
